  2. Hi guys, I have a shaking, bobbing effect happening with my pmdg 737 wingtips. As soon as the a/c gets about 150 - 200 feet airborne, it starts this rapid bobbing, and no matter what altitude i fly, it doesnt stop. its virtually unflyable. Very strange thing is, that it does it now with the stock fsx 737 too, but not with the pdmg 800 or 900 without the wingtips, only with wingtips. i have tried disconnecting and reconnecting controllers, but nothing works to fix it. I have a feeling its in a configuration somewhere in fsx thats stuffed up, but only affects 737's with wingtips, and no other aircraft. cheers. steve reddy.
